Catawba Valley Community College adds Matt Grantham to Men’s Basketball Staff

Catawba Valley Community College men’s basketball coach Bryan Garmroth has announced the addition of Matt Grantham to his coaching staff.

Grantham comes to the Red Hawks after spending the past three seasons as an assistant men’s basketball coach at North Carolina Wesleyan University.

“We are very excited to have Matt join us at CVCC,” Garmroth said. “He is a young and very enthusiastic coach. His work ethic and energy level are second to none, and he will be a huge asset to our program. He has worked the last two years for John Thompson at North Carolina Wesleyan. Coach Thompson is a great coach and highly respected across the country.”

During two years at North Carolina Wesleyan, Grantham helped lead the Battling Bishops to a 2017-18 East Division regular-season championship. He also assisted four players in earning all-conference honors and one athlete in earning conference Rookie of the Year accolades during those two seasons.

Most importantly, every senior during Grantham’s tenure at Wesleyan graduated on time, and 10 players earned academic all-conference honors.

A graduate of East Carolina University, Grantham comes from a coaching tradition-rich family. HIs father Greg, who helped found the North Carolina Basketball Coaches Association (NCBCA), has been a long-time basketball coach at White Oak High School in Jacksonville.

“Matt’s father Greg Grantham is a retired and highly successful North Carolina high school basketball coach,” Garmroth said. “Matt not only brings a lot of basketball knowledge, but he is a recruiting warrior. In his two years at North Carolina Wesleyan, he has developed a lot of recruiting relationships. We are very fortunate to have him at CVCC.”

Matt was a team manager for the East Carolina University men’s basketball program while pursuing his undergraduate studies, including a major in Psychology and minor in business management.

Grantham also has experience working with major college basketball camps, including at the University of North Carolina, Duke University, North Carolina State University and the University of Maryland.

“I am extremely excited for the opportunity to join coach Garmroth’s staff at Catawba Valley,” Grantham said. “He is a proven veteran that has coached at every level of college basketball. I look forward to learning all I can from him, as well as applying my own knowledge and experience to help our program compete at a championship level.”
